Search ChatGPT plugins by keyword
Until OpenAI categorizes the plugin store, there are two ways to find new plugins to try. You can browse all ChatGPT plugins, new and popular.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
Or, you can use the search to find plugins by keyword.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
Note that search results only return plugins with the exact keyword in the plugin name or description. Plugins with similar names or functionality are not included.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
If you can’t find any plugins, try searching for related keywords or functionality types. Chances are there’s something out there with the capabilities you need.
Install the ChatGPT plugins
You can install one or more plugins by clicking the Install button next to each one. Although ChatGPT limits you to a maximum of three plugins per chat, you can install as many plugins as you like.
When you click Install, two things could happen. The plugin can be installed instantly, or you can be redirected to a third-party website to create an account to use the third-party service together with ChatGPT.
The Reflect Notes app, for example, redirects you to create an account and asks you to authorize ChatGPT with your account.
Screenshot from Reflect.app, June 2023
Once the app is installed and connected to any required third-party accounts, you can use the plugin in ChatGPT.
While OpenAI checks plugins for conflicting usage usage policiesit is up to you to investigate third-party ChatGPT plugins as you would WordPress plugins or Chrome extensions before giving them access to your credit card or data.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
A quick web search for most plugins will yield an official website, media mentions, or directory listings with more details.
Screenshot from Google, June 2023
Ask ChatGPT for directions
If you’re not sure what to do with your new ChatGPT plugin, you can ask for suggestions. Start by activating the plugin in a new chat with a check mark.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
Once you’ve activated the plugin, ask ChatGPT for guidance on your next steps.
You can ask for information on how to use the plugin or ask for advice on how to use it for a specific task, whether broad or specific.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
Discover the most effective directions
In addition to asking for instructions on how to use the plugin, you can also ask what prompts you should use for the plugin and the task at hand.
In the example below, I switched to the SEO Assistant plugin and asked for the best directions for using it.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
ChatGPT shares the description of the plugin in this case, followed by directions mainly focused on keyword research.
Find out which enabled plugin is best for the task
If you find a few plugins with similar functionality, you can activate up to three of them and ask ChatGPT which one will be best for your task.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023

Explore how ChatGPT plugins request a response
How has ChatGPT received its response to your contribution?
With plugins, you can sometimes find this out by expanding the dropdown while the plugin is working to fulfill your request.
In this example, VoxScript used the DuckDuckGo search results to find the answer to my question, but eventually failed after two attempts.
Screenshot from ChatGPT, June 2023
Reformulate your request
Interestingly, the plugin used in the example above answered a similar question in a previous chat using different sources of DuckDuckGo search results.
It’s an essential reminder that you may need to do this rephrase your request to ChatGPT and any enabled plugin more than once to get the information you want.
Making even the slightest alteration to your message can be the determining factor in receiving a valuable response instead of an inaccurate, incomplete or useless one.
